About: ebm-papst is a company organization based out in Mulfingen, Germany. It is known for research contribution in the topics: Rotor (electric) & Stator. The organization has 572 authors who have published 736 publications receiving 3763 citations.

TL;DR: A motor with an external rotor (28) fits in a fan casing (22). Fan blades (30) on the external rotor convey air through the fan casing and an electric heat register (44) uses a detachable connection (38,42) like a locking connecting to make a releasable connection with the fan case.
Abstract: A motor with an external rotor (28) fits in a fan casing (22). Fan blades (30) on the external rotor convey air through the fan casing. An electric heat register (44) uses a detachable connection (38,42) like a locking connecting to make a releasable connection with the fan casing.

TL;DR: In this article, the electronic commutating electric motor has a network rectifier for rectifying a network changeover voltage to an intermediate circuit-direct current voltage (U-Z) and an integrated buck converter is provided for reducing the intermediate circuit direct current voltage.
Abstract: The electronic commutating electric motor (1) has a network rectifier (2) for rectifying a network changeover voltage (U-N) to an intermediate circuit-direct current voltage (U-Z), and has a commutating electronics (4) for controlling three-standed motor coil. An integrated buck converter (10) is provided for reducing the intermediate circuit-direct current voltage that is supplied over the network rectifier.

TL;DR: In this paper, a plastic bearing part is connected to a shaft by injection molding of two components to a plastic material, such that a part of a transitional area between the bearing part and the rotor permanent magnet is formed by an integral joint.
Abstract: The method involves connecting a plastic bearing part (64) to a shaft by injection molding of two components to a plastic material. Hard ferromagnetic particles (74) of a rotor permanent magnet are arranged to the plastic material such that a part of a transitional area between the bearing part and the rotor permanent magnet is formed by an integral joint. The rotor thus formed is embedded in a mini fan. An independent claim is also included for a mini fan, comprising fan blades.

TL;DR: In this paper, a DC intermediate circuit (170) with a capacitor (178) supplies current to the output stage of a stator and a commutation process is executed for a predetermined commutation time point.
Abstract: The method involves providing an output stage (122) for influencing the current feed of a cable in a stator. A DC intermediate circuit (170) with a capacitor (178) supplies current to the output stage. A commutation process is executed for a predetermined commutation time point in the output stage. The commutation time point is determined based on the energetic recovery system in the capacitor. An independent claim is also included for an electro motor comprising a rotor.
